HandBrake is available for Linux, macOS, and Windows, making it among the best multi-platform video converters. You can crop the video and add scaling, too. To help with organization, Handbrake enables you to add tags to the output file. There's a range of options, too, allowing you to add chapter markers, subtitles, and video filters.

These presets optimize the video conversion for your desired device, whether that be a smartphone, laptop, or TV. It is also easy to use, offering built-in presets for specific devices. Unlike soundKonverter, HandBrake focuses solely on video conversion. The app is probably best known as a Windows media converter, but the popular open-source video converter is also available for Linux, too. HandBrake is a well-established name in the media converter market. Although most computers don't come with disc drives these days, you can use soundKonverter to rip audio CDs, too, thanks to the cdparanoia back end. For those who like to keep their media organized, the app can read, write, and preserve tags as well. The biggest draw here is the speed soundKonverter is among the fastest Linux media converters. Switching between output types also enable you to specify file-specific options like compression rate for FLAC files, and output quality for Ogg Vorbis formats.
